osmo-trx-lms doesn't exit nor recover if device is unplugged

Description

Especially with USB based devices, it's not completely unlikely that once upon a time there is a bus reset or some other event that makes the device disappear.

The current behavior of osmo-trx-lms is to start spewing error messages, but it will not terminate, nor will it recover after the USB device is re-attached.

Wed Jun 13 15:34:30 2018 DMAIN <0000> LMSDevice.cpp:509 [tid=140361119426304] LMS: Device receive timed out
Wed Jun 13 15:34:30 2018 DMAIN <0000> radioInterface.cpp:319 [tid=140361119426304] Receive error 340
Wed Jun 13 15:34:30 2018 DMAIN <0000> LMSDevice.cpp:507 [tid=140361119426304] chan 0 recv buffer of len 0 expect dc7d50 got 0 (0) diff=ffffffffff2382b0
Wed Jun 13 15:34:30 2018 DMAIN <0000> LMSDevice.cpp:509 [tid=140361119426304] LMS: Device receive timed out
Wed Jun 13 15:34:30 2018 DMAIN <0000> radioInterface.cpp:319 [tid=140361119426304] Receive error 0
Wed Jun 13 15:34:30 2018 DMAIN <0000> LMSDevice.cpp:507 [tid=140361119426304] chan 0 recv buffer of len 0 expect dc7d50 got 0 (0) diff=ffffffffff2382b0
Wed Jun 13 15:34:30 2018 DMAIN <0000> LMSDevice.cpp:509 [tid=140361119426304] LMS: Device receive timed out
Wed Jun 13 15:34:30 2018 DMAIN <0000> radioInterface.cpp:319 [tid=140361119426304] Receive error 0
Wed Jun 13 15:34:30 2018 DMAIN <0000> LMSDevice.cpp:507 [tid=140361119426304] chan 0 recv buffer of len 0 expect dc7d50 got 0 (0) diff=ffffffffff2382b0

I think the easiest would be to exit the program and have systemd respawn it, like we do with other osmocom programs
